Output 8aa2da14a49d1b9ad0c9dbd8dc917ea1afb9ca2e7fa0abb75ae260c19ba27eb9:0

value
2037764024
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cd27ace75c468172ff4e5eb0b3d020b9cb539c7 OP_EQUAL
address
3JuR6zeS7xnf5riQjDnXuQAenzGLSRpFkY
transaction
8aa2da14a49d1b9ad0c9dbd8dc917ea1afb9ca2e7fa0abb75ae260c19ba27eb9
confirmations
251526
spent
true